Brief summary

Patients with HOCM and severe LVOT obstruction can remain asymptomatic while significant cellular and structural changes of the heart (adverse remodeling) may occur preceding heart failure and rhythm disorders. Hence, preventing adverse remodeling through LVOT desobstruction may have significant impact on cardiac function and geometry in this particular population, as it is in symptomatic patients. The investigators will assess functional and structural characteristics of the myocardium in asymptomatic vs. symptomatic patients with severe LVOT obstruction before and after PTSMA, using advanced imaging studies with LGE-CMR and echocardiography.

Detailed description

The trial consists of three cohorts 1. Symptomatic HOCM patients with severe LVOT obstruction undergoing PTSMA (reference group) 2. Asymptomatic HOCM patients with severe LVOT obstruction undergoing PTSMA (study group) 3. Asymptomatic HOCM patients with severe LVOT obstruction with no intervention (observation group)

Masking description

Technicians and/or imaging cardiologists involved in image analysis will not be informed about the procedure in order to have an unbiased analysis at baseline. At follow-up, treated patients will have akinetic/infarcted proximal septum that will be noticed during image acquisition. However, the pre-PTSMA status (symptomatic vs. asymptomatic) will be blinded for the analysis.

Inclusion criteria

* Age \> 40 yrs * HOCM diagnosed by experienced cardiologists (European Society of Cardiology (ESC)-certified imaging cardiologists and/or finalized fellowship imaging) * LVOT obstruction \>30 mmHg pressure gradient in rest, or \>50 mmHg during exercise by TTE and/or invasive measurement, performed experienced (imaging) cardiologists * Symptomatic (NYHA class \>2 or CCS class \>2) * Asymptomatic: free of any dyspnea/chest pain or discomfort associated with LVOT obstruction

Exclusion criteria

* LV wall thickness \<15 mm * Other conditions responsible for hypertrophy (e.g. hypertension, aortic valve disease) * Moderate to severe mitral valve regurgitation * Systolic anterior motion of the mitral valve * Coronary artery disease requiring intervention * Pregnancy
